About the role

This position is part of the Facilities team and is responsible for general maintenance duties, building repairs, snow removal, grounds care and other related activities. This role works closely with departments across YW and requires cross-collaboration, adaptability, initiative and a solution focused approach.

This position is a full-time permanent position working 37.5 hours per week, Monday to Friday with additional on-call rotation. Some evening or weekend work may be required based on operational need.

WHAT YOU'LL DO:

  • Perform a wide range of maintenance tasks including painting, drywall, cabinets repairs, baseboard installation, minor plumbing electrical work and other repair work, using appropriate YW equipment.
  • Complete regular daily walk-throughs of indoor and outdoor common areas to ensure the property is optimally and professionally maintained and in good working order. Note and attend to minor and major maintenance fixes or damage.
  • Manage the upkeep of parking areas, grounds and patios including snow and ice removal.
  • General custodial duties as required such as loading dock support and heavy garbage removal.
  • Assist with furniture, equipment and supply moves.
  • Support Building Operators with preventative maintenance of heating, cooling, and air handling equipment as well as mechanical equipment including pumps, motors, fans, and heating coils.
  • Monitor and respond to work requests in a detailed and timely manner; communicate expected timelines of completion as required.
  • Use Work Management Systems to communicate regular updates with team.
  • Liaise with various contractors and ensure the required repairs are performed.
  • Independently troubleshoot problems and collaborate with team members to find solutions.
  • Maintain general understanding of relevant Building Management Systems.
  • Other related duties assigned by the Facilities Supervisor or Manager.

WHAT YOU'LL BRING:

  • High school diploma or equivalent qualification required.
  • Minimum of 2 years’ working experience in a similar role.
  • Experience with light trade work (plumbing, electrical, carpentry, painting, locksmith, etc.).
  • Solid experience with plumbing and electrical systems.
  • Ability to work with hardware tools and power equipment.
  • Extremely organized with good communication skills.
  • Detail-oriented with an aptitude for problem-solving.
  • Ability to operate snow removal equipment.
  • Good communication skills.
  • Ability to work independently as well as part of a team.
  • WHMIS and valid First Aid certification.
  • Experience working in all weather elements, both inside and outside facilities.
  • This role is physically strenuous, requires lifting up to 50 lbs, moving office furniture, equipment, and supplies.
  • Requires a clear Police and Vulnerable Sector check.
  • Class 5 Driver’s License and clean driver’s abstract.

YWCA USA is on a mission to eliminate racism, empower women, stand up for social justice, help families, and strengthen communities. We are one of the oldest and largest women's organizations in the nation, serving over 2 million women, girls, and their families.

YWCA has been at the forefront of the most pressing social movements for more than 160 years — from voting rights to civil rights, from affordable housing to pay equity, from violence prevention to health care reform. Today, we combine programming and advocacy in order to generate institutional change in three key areas: racial justice and civil rights, empowerment and economic advancement of women and girls, and health and safety of women and girls..
